Western business school (WBS) in Pune offers a two-year full-time MBA (++) program. Admission to this program requires a bachelors degree in any discipline with at least 50% marks for general category students and 45% for reserved category students. Additionally applicants must have valid scores from national level entrance exams such as CAT, XAT, MAT or CMAT. The selection process at WBS is profile based and considers various factors. 

Written Test--25%

Academic Performance--25%

Group Discussion and Personal Interview- 40%

Work Experience--10%

  • Applicants must have passed Class 12 (or equivalent) from a recognised board.
  • Physics, Chemistry, Biology (or Biotechnology), and English are required in class 12th.
  • General Category (UR), OBC, EWS: Applicants need to have secured a minimum of 50% marks in the aggregate in Class 12.
  • Applicants belonging to Scheduled Caste (SC) or Scheduled Tribe (ST) categories need to have secured a minimum of 40% marks in the aggregate in Class 12.
  • The candidate's age should be at least 17 years old but not exceed 35 years on December 31st of the application year.

Pursuing a BSc in Agriculture from Visva Bharati University is a good choice in terms of placements. The details of the BSc batch 2025 are yet to be released on the official website. The University has released the NIRF report 2025 which includes the placement details for batch 2024. According to the report, 9 UG 4 year students were placed out of the total 191 graduated students during Visva Bharati Universitys placements 2024 with a median package of INR 5.25 LPA.
